Code Number: 7D20.90
Demo Title: Nuclear Explosions
Condition: Excellent
Principle: Nuclear Fission, Nuclear Fusion, Chain Reaction
Area of Study: Modern Physics
Equipment:
"Race for the Superbomb", PBS Home Video, 1999, "Trinity and Beyond: The Atomic Bomb Movie", Goldhil Video, 1997, Nuclear Bomb Effects Computer.
Many movies are now available from YouTube.
Procedure:
The movies give a chronological time line of early nuclear bomb testing.
The "Nuclear Bomb Effects Computer" is a two-sided, circular slide rule that will enable you to calculate multiple measurements of a nuclear bomb explosion.
